Exon_43 Running the ALCHEMY2000 program at MUSC.

The ALCHEMY2000 program is a desktop product for
viewing molecules. The program can integrate nicely
with MS Office to perform spreadsheet operations.
The program has a nice 2D sketcher which can feed sketches
into the 3D builder. There are a number of atomic
rendering options as well. The program is ONLY
on the BCR Dell.
